Transaction 143797602e154c10273bf212b8939854da5c3a53566a64320015a4a4f1089b07
1 Input
1 Output
-
143797602e154c10273bf212b8939854da5c3a53566a64320015a4a4f1089b07:0
- value
- 278357
- script pubkey
- OP_0 OP_PUSHBYTES_20 4836b27e8ccd718854052f5b1f07af3485d3b8c7
- address
- bc1qfqmtyl5ve4ccs4q99ad37pa0xjza8wx8tcywut